Overall Satisfaction with Canva

I use Canva for work (the paid version) every single day and I create social media posts for clients all around the world. I also partnered with Digital Marketing Agencies and I provide social media posts, banners, flyers and much more. Since I work as a graphic designer, Canva helps me to save a lot of time because of all the tools available (paid version). I can also find a lot of high-quality pictures, icons, etc. for free instead of having to use websites like Pixabay, Pexels, FlatIcon, etc.
  • They have a great stock of images and icons available
  • Templates are also a huge plus so depending on the design I don't need to create everything from scratch
  • The paid version is not expensive in my opinion based on how much time you can save just by using this tool
  • It's easy to use even for someone who is just starting
  • I would like to be able to add shadow behind text or icons
  • Easier way to center icons, texts, images, etc
  • Find a better way to find folders / templates I created in the past just by typing certain keywords
  • I work full time as graphic designer and web-developer. Canva is by far the best tool for certain jobs like Social Media Content, Facebook Covers, etc.
  • It saves me a lot of time when I need to find images and icons. It also allows me to keep images I upload inside folders which is a huge plus.
  • The templates available are awesome, it gives me tons of ideas & inspirations when I need to create something new for a client.
Canva can really save you a lot of time compared to Adobe Photoshop if used well. You can save images, find new images and icons all inside the platform. You can also use pre-made templates and you will never have storage space problems which I absolutely love! When I use Adobe Photoshop I always have to find something else that I can delete in order to create a new design which can be very frustrating.
Canva is ideal for anyone looking to create great designs (Social Media posts, brochures, flyers, and even a basic logo). Canva wouldn't be the best option if you are looking to design something complex, remove background, crop items, add effects on images or texts, etc.
